According to this article, the drives between ,,half-seasoners'' divide like that..
https://www.rallit.fi/esapekka-lappi...auden-ohjelma/
Mikkelsen:
- Monte-Carlo
- Croatia
- CER
- Japan
Sordo:
- Portugal
- Sardegna
- Acropolis
Lappi:
- Sweden
- Kenya
- Poland
- Latvia
- Finland
- Chile
Although I don't understand the point of Sordo doing 3 rallies only.. better let Mikkelsen get used to the car or give Suninem a chance. I doubt they would do worse on these rallies.

Mikkelsen said in an interview he had contract for 5 rallies, all tarmac rounds and one that was not decided.
I would expect Acropolis as the most likely candidate, based on his recent performance there.
But so far I don't quite understand their approach with him. Suninen got a test rally before his starts on both tarmac and gravel last year + test days and he also tested at end of 2022. Mikkelsen got 1 day test.
What did they then expect vs guys with 20+ starts in Rally1? (even Fourmaux had 12 and Munster 2). Note that Evans used like half the season to get used to Rally1 and Sordo somehow never really managed it.
Most likely explanation was that Mikkelsen was just told to finish (a bit like Lappi in Japan).
